Property summary

1722-24 S Broad St is a 1956-built commercial in the Newbold section of 19145, last assessed at $1,223,400. Built before the 1978 federal lead-paint ban, the structure may carry lead-based paint risks if original surfaces remain. The property has been transferred 6 times in city records. All 1 code violations on file have been resolved. The property is held by Prudential Savings Bank, a corporation with a portfolio of 2 Philadelphia properties.
